Subject: Re: [PATCH 3/7] ARM: OMAP: Add command line option for I2C bus speed
Date: Thu, 5 Mar 2009 08:20:43 -0800 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20090305162043.GY6784@atomide.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20090304215105.21101.88365.stgit@localhost>
* Tony Lindgren <tony@atomide.com> [090304 13:51]:
> From: Jarkko Nikula <jarkko.nikula@nokia.com>
>
> This patch adds a new command line option "i2c_bus=bus_id,clkrate" into
> I2C bus registration helper. Purpose of the option is to override the
> default board specific bus speed which is supplied by the
> omap_register_i2c_bus.
>
> The default bus speed is typically set to speed of slowest I2C chip on the
> bus and overriding allow to use some experimental configurations or updated
> chip versions without any kernel modifications.
Jarkko, this should also be in Documentation/kernel-parameters.txt. Can
you please reply with a patch for that, and I'll fold it into this
patch?
Also, maybe it should be called omap_i2c_bus instead of i2c_bus?

> diff --git a/arch/arm/plat-omap/i2c.c b/arch/arm/plat-omap/i2c.c
> index 3e95954..aa70e43 100644
> --- a/arch/arm/plat-omap/i2c.c
> +++ b/arch/arm/plat-omap/i2c.c
> @@ -119,6 +119,46 @@ static void __init omap_i2c_mux_pins(int bus)
> omap_cfg_reg(scl);
> }
>
> +static int __init omap_i2c_nr_ports(void)
> +{
> + int ports = 0;
> +
> + if (cpu_class_is_omap1())
> + ports = 1;
> + else if (cpu_is_omap24xx())
> + ports = 2;
> + else if (cpu_is_omap34xx())
> + ports = 3;
> +
> + return ports;
> +}
> +
> +/**
> + * omap_i2c_bus_setup - Process command line options for the I2C bus speed
> + * @str: String of options
> + *
> + * This function allow to override the default I2C bus speed for given I2C
> + * bus with a command line option.
> + *
> + * Format: i2c_bus=bus_id,clkrate (in kHz)
> + *
> + * Returns 1 on success, 0 otherwise.
> + */
> +static int __init omap_i2c_bus_setup(char *str)
> +{
> + int ports;
> + int ints[3];
> +
> + ports = omap_i2c_nr_ports();
> + get_options(str, 3, ints);
> + if (ints[0] < 2 || ints[1] < 1 || ints[1] > ports)
> + return 0;
> + i2c_rate[ints[1] - 1] = ints[2];
> +
> + return 1;
> +}
> +__setup("i2c_bus=", omap_i2c_bus_setup);
> +
> /**
> * omap_register_i2c_bus - register I2C bus with device descriptors
> * @bus_id: bus id counting from number 1
> @@ -132,19 +172,12 @@ int __init omap_register_i2c_bus(int bus_id, u32 clkrate,
> struct i2c_board_info const *info,
> unsigned len)
> {
> - int ports, err;
> + int err;
> struct platform_device *pdev;
> struct resource *res;
> resource_size_t base, irq;
>
> - if (cpu_class_is_omap1())
> - ports = 1;
> - else if (cpu_is_omap24xx())
> - ports = 2;
> - else if (cpu_is_omap34xx())
> - ports = 3;
> -
> - BUG_ON(bus_id < 1 || bus_id > ports);
> + BUG_ON(bus_id < 1 || bus_id > omap_i2c_nr_ports());
>
> if (info) {
> err = i2c_register_board_info(bus_id, info, len);
> @@ -153,7 +186,8 @@ int __init omap_register_i2c_bus(int bus_id, u32 clkrate,
> }
>
> pdev = &omap_i2c_devices[bus_id - 1];
> - *(u32 *)pdev->dev.platform_data = clkrate;
> + if (i2c_rate[bus_id - 1] == 0)
> + i2c_rate[bus_id - 1] = clkrate;
>
> if (bus_id == 1) {
> res = pdev->resource;
>
